Precision ranged between 5% and 10% RSD for elements found at the 10 μg gâ 1 level or higher, while this value could deteriorate to 20% for analytes found at the sub-μg gâ 1 level. Overall, the technique evaluated presents many advantages for the fast and accurate multi-element analysis of these materials, avoiding laborious digestion procedures and minimizing the risk of analyte losses due to the formation of volatile compounds.
